Wise Advice

If God gave you one wish, what would it be? Though God loved Solomon from the time he was born (II Samuel 12:24), when God said to ask for whatever he wanted, Solomon found God’s favor by asking for wisdom instead of riches and power (II Chronicles 1:11-12).

Fear God and keep his commandments, for this is the whole duty of man.
Ecclesiastes 12:13

Before Solomon was born he was chosen to build the temple, something his father David wanted to do (I Chronicles 28:3). When Solomon prayed and dedicated the temple, God showed up in a mighty way (II Chronicles 7:1). Even though Solomon was a great king, he had his faults. He sinned against God through his activities with women from other countries (Nehemiah 13:26). In Ecclesiastes, Solomon looked back on his life – his riches, his education and his accomplishments – and he concluded that all of it was vanity. He summed up the purpose of life with today’s verse.

Today, you have that advice gleaned from all of Solomon’s wisdom and experience, not to mention Jesus’ greatest commands to love God and others. Seek to live a life pleasing to God, then pray that He will rise up national leaders like Solomon who will humble themselves in prayer and rely on God’s wisdom.

Godly Choices

The movie Jurassic World recently brought in over $511 million in its opening weekend, becoming the highest grossing global film of all time. Yet it is the film’s lead actor, Chris Pratt, who goes against Hollywood’s standards and demonstrates eternal qualities. Pratt values his faith in God and his family more than his fame and wealth. Chris and his wife Anna have been married for six years. When their son Jack was born premature, they spent weeks praying at the baby’s side. “We were scared for a long time. We prayed a lot,” said Pratt. “It restored my faith in God; not that it needed to be restored, but it really defined it.”

When Joseph woke from sleep, he did as the angel of the Lord commanded him: he took his wife.
Matthew 1:24

Another man, Joseph of Nazareth, also lived out his faith through his actions. God’s choice for Jesus’ earthly father was a man of integrity and courage. When God sent an angel to verify Mary‘s story, Joseph willingly obeyed in spite of the public humiliation he would face.

As you seek the Lord for daily decisions, pray and listen carefully to the Holy Spirit. Make choices that honor God. Pray also that America’s leaders will do the same.

Amazing Plans

When America’s forefathers were anticipating the future of their fledgling nation, they could not possibly have imagined the cultural and economic complexities challenging America today. John Adams, though, acknowledged the source and power behind their vision of the future: “the right to freedom, being the gift of God Almighty, is not in the power of Man to alienate.”

In the Bible, God had big plans for a man named Joseph. He gave him dreams about a place of service and honor being prepared specifically for him. Joseph’s aspirations to fulfill God’s plan made him a target for resentment. His adversaries thought they could derail both his dreams and God’s purposes by contriving to have Joseph imprisoned and enslaved. They succeeded in putting Joseph in prison – but ultimately his enemy’s antics merely served to prepare Joseph for God’s amazing plans.

Mortal man is not the author and finisher of your story…or of America’s future. Regardless of what you see happening in the news today, be assured that no evil can upend God’s purposes and plans. Be confident and committed to pray for the nation’s leaders today.
